What is Rust?
Rust is a multiplayer survival game developed by Facepunch Studios. The game is an open-world game in which players face harsh survival conditions, fight for resources, build shelters and compete against other players. Rust was released in early access in 2013 and has since enjoyed tremendous popularity and an active community of players.
The multiplayer project was fully released on 8 February 2018 for both Windows and macOS platforms. Having become a success in the PC market, it was only a matter of time before the game appeared on consoles. Rust is based on the Unity game engine. A console version of Rust will see the light of day on May 21, 2021 for P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ox One X, Xbox Series S and Xbox Series X.
Rust gameplay
In Rust, players start with minimal resources and weapons and venture into a dangerous world full of wildlife, hostile animals and other players. The game maintains a high degree of freedom and non-linearity in gameplay. Players can explore the world, gather resources, create items, build shelters and interact with other players.
One of the key aspects of Rust is survival. Players need to keep track of their basic needs such as food, water and heat to stay alive. They must search for and gather resources to build weapons, tools and protection from enemies. Danger lurks at every turn and players must be careful not to fall prey to wild animals or hostile players.
There is also an extensive construction toolkit in the game of Rust. Players can create their own shelters, built from a variety of materials, to protect themselves from enemies and conserve their resources. Base building allows players to create defensive structures, traps and other devices to protect their possessions.

Cross-platform rules in Rust
Unfortunately for Windows and macOS players, cross-platform play in Rust is only available in Rust: Console Edition, that is, on past and current generation consoles. So, for example, a person with a PlayStation 5 can play with a friend who has an Xbox Series X.
There are potentially two main reasons why the developers made cross-platform available only for the console version of the game. The first is that since its release, Rust: Console Edition has had its own development roadmap and has evolved in a slightly different way than the PC version of the game. The second is that players with gamepads are in roughly different circumstances, while having Windows and macOS players on the same map as them could introduce an imbalance, as it is assumed that players with a mouse and keyboard may have an advantage over those with gamepads.
So far Facepunch Studios have made no new promises or announcements regarding the appearance of a cross-platform game in the PC version of Rust, so unfortunately you certainly can't expect to be able to join your friends on PlayStation or Xbox anytime soon if you have PC.
